Derfel Posted September 5, 2008 Author Share Posted September 5, 2008 Hi! Well here's the result of a good few hours of testing. 1. The problem occurs with *every* scenario; prefabricated or home-made, however, it manifests itself a little differently. In the pre-fab scens the vehicles seem to scatter all over the map once the joining player leaves the setup phase. Sometimes they return to their original positions when given orders. 2. The vanishing/dispersing vehicles *always* belong to the player joining the game (i.e not the Host). We tried hosting from both machines. Which I suppose means that the problem is not with the graphics card (as we have different cards in our machines) 3. Toggling shadows on or off has *no* effect whatsoever on this problem 4. Graphic settings has *no* effect on the problem (we've tried every combination we could think of) 5. Some vehicles *occasionally* re-appear during play 6. Vehicles are visible during the setup phase. 7. The vehicles are invisible to the joining player, but they are there and functioning, you can see the outgoing fire for instance. 8. The floating icon also vanishes. Oh, and; 9. The game cannot be paused. How annoying is THAT! Since TCP games can't be saved I can't send any sample.
